ТRIAC technology and Sentera’s devices

ТRIAC technology and Sentera’s devices

Precise fan speed control through TRIAC (Triode for Alternating Current) technology plays a crucial role in enhancing the efficiency and long life span of motors and connected devices in one or multiple HVAC systems. By regulating the phase angle, TRIAC technology ensures smooth, gradual adjustment in speed, preventing sudden voltage leakages. This reduces mechanical strain on the motor and minimizes wear and tear of its components and the other connected devices, which can lead to power failure or even irreparable damages. With optimized speed control, the motor should operate at lower temperatures, reducing energy consumption and extending its lifespan. Electronic fan speed controllers

Electronic fan speed controllers

Electronic or variable fan speed controllers offer continuously variable speed control for AC fans. They use phase angle control, Triac technology, to reduce the motor voltage. The lower the motor voltage, the lower the fan speed.

Frequency inverters in industrial environment

Frequency inverters in industrial environment

In most industrial environments, the precise speed and torque moment control should be viewed as a critical part of precise fan speed control process. Sometimes the well-regulated fan speed control depends on the right choice of frequency drives and fan, otherwise we might end up not well prepared for the consequences of fake or poorly produced devices running our fans and motors. Frequency drives provide infinitely variable speed control for AC fans or pumps in HVAC applications. They are suitable for regulating the speed of various motor types as single phase AC motors, IE2, IE3 and IE4 induction motors, AC permanent magnet motors, brushless DC motors, synchronous reluctance motors, etc. The used IGBT transistor technology is supposed to vary both motor voltage and frequency via pulse width modulation (PWM), which results in a very precise and efficient motor control. You can change or add new requirements for precise motor control thanks to the integrated macros.
